Our Comprehensive Residential Pest Control Process

Our residential pest control service is a meticulous process designed to effectively manage and eliminate pest issues. From the initial inspection to follow-up visits, we focus on thoroughness and long-term prevention.

Initial Assessment and Inspection

Every effective pest control strategy begins with a detailed inspection. Our trained technicians will carefully examine your property, both indoors and outdoors, to identify the types of pests present, the extent of the infestation, and potential entry points. This step is critical for developing a targeted and effective treatment plan.

Identifying Pest Entry Points

Pests can enter homes through surprisingly small openings. We look for cracks in foundations, gaps around windows and doors, utility line entry points, and damage to screens or vents. Sealing these areas is a vital part of preventing future infestations.

Assessing Contributing Factors

We also evaluate factors that might be attracting pests, such as standing water, overgrown vegetation near the house, or easily accessible food sources. Addressing these environmental conditions is crucial for long-term pest management.

Customized Treatment Plan Development

Based on the inspection findings, we create a personalized treatment plan. This plan outlines the recommended treatments, the methods we will use, and a schedule for service. We discuss the plan with you, explaining our approach and answering any questions you may have.

Targeted Treatment Applications

Our treatments are specifically chosen to effectively eliminate the identified pests while minimizing impact on your family and pets. We utilize a combination of techniques, which may include baiting, trapping, spot treatments, and barrier applications, depending on the pest and the situation.

Integrated Pest Management (IPM) Principles

We often employ Integrated Pest Management (IPM) principles, which involve using a combination of methods including biological control, habitat modification, and reduced-risk pesticides when necessary. This holistic approach aims for sustainable pest management.

Ongoing Monitoring and Prevention

Pest control is not always a one-time event. We offer ongoing monitoring and preventative services to ensure your home remains pest-free. Regular service visits can help detect and address potential issues before they become major problems.

Seasonal Pest Considerations

Different pests are more active during different seasons. Our service plans can be adjusted to proactively address seasonal pest threats, such as rodents seeking shelter in the fall or increased insect activity in the warmer months.

Exclusion Techniques

We can also recommend and implement exclusion techniques, such as sealing cracks and gaps, installing door sweeps, and repairing screens, to physically prevent pests from entering your home.

Understanding Common Residential Pest Problems in Pocatello, ID

Homeowners in Pocatello, ID face a variety of common pest challenges throughout the year. Recognizing the signs of an infestation early is key to effective and efficient pest control. Our team at Pocatello Pest Pros frequently addresses the following issues:

Ant Infestations

Ants are one of the most common household pests. They are often attracted to food sources, venturing indoors in search of crumbs or sugar spills. Even small trails of ants can indicate a much larger colony nearby. While generally harmless, they can contaminate food and become a persistent nuisance. Addressing ant infestations requires identifying and treating the source colony, not just the visible ants.

Spider Control

Spiders are a common sight in homes, with some species being more concerning than others. While most spiders are not venomous, their webs can be unsightly, and their presence can cause anxiety for some individuals. Effective spider control involves treating areas where spiders are likely to build webs and addressing the insects they feed on.

Rodent Control

Mice and rats are not just unwelcome guests; they can also pose significant health risks and cause damage to property by gnawing on wires and structures. Signs of rodent activity include droppings, gnaw marks, and scratching sounds in walls or ceilings. Prompt action is crucial for rodent control to prevent them from multiplying and causing extensive damage.

Bed Bug Extermination

Bed bugs are notoriously difficult to eliminate without professional help. These tiny insects feed on human blood and can cause itchy bites and significant discomfort. Infestations often start after travel and can spread quickly. Dealing with bed bugs requires a comprehensive and multi-faceted approach to ensure all life stages are eradicated.

Bee and Wasp Removal

While pollinators are important, nests of bees or wasps in or near your home can be a serious safety hazard, especially for individuals with allergies. Removing these nests safely and effectively requires expertise and the right equipment. It's generally not advisable for homeowners to attempt removal themselves.

Cockroach Control

Cockroaches are resilient pests known for spreading bacteria and allergens. Their presence can be a sign of underlying sanitation issues and can be very difficult to get rid of without professional-grade treatments. Effective cockroach control involves identifying the species and applying targeted treatments to harborage areas.

Termite Treatment

Termites can cause significant structural damage to properties, often unseen until the infestation is severe. They feed on wood and can silently weaken the integrity of your home. Signs of termites may include discarded wings, mud tubes, or damaged wood. Early detection and professional treatment are vital to prevent costly repairs.

Signs You Need Residential Pest Control

Being aware of the subtle clues that indicate a pest problem can save you a significant amount of time, money, and stress in the long run. Many residential pest issues start small and can escalate rapidly if not addressed promptly. Here are some common signs that your home might benefit from professional residential pest control services in Pocatello, ID:

Unusual Scents or Odors

Certain pests emit distinct odors. A musky smell can indicate the presence of rodents or cockroaches, while a sweet, sickly smell might suggest a significant insect infestation. If you notice persistent unpleasant smells that you can't attribute to anything obvious, it's wise to investigate further or consult with a pest control professional. These odors are often concentrated in areas where pests are congregating or nesting.

Droppings or Excrement

One of the most definitive signs of pest activity is the presence of droppings. The size and shape of the droppings can help identify the type of pest. Rodent droppings are typically pellet-shaped, while cockroach droppings resemble coffee grounds or black pepper. Discovering these in areas like pantries, under sinks, or in secluded corners is a strong indicator of an infestation that requires attention.

Gnaw Marks on Furniture or Structures

Rodents like mice and rats constantly gnaw to keep their teeth from growing too long. If you find unexplained gnaw marks on wooden furniture, baseboards, electrical wires, or even food packaging, it's a clear sign of rodent activity. This can not only be destructive but also a fire hazard if electrical wires are involved. Identifying the extent of the gnawing can help determine the severity of the infestation.

Visible Pest Sightings

While some pests are nocturnal and hide during the day, seeing them during daylight hours often suggests a larger or more established infestation. Spotting a cockroach scurrying across the floor, a mouse darting under furniture, or finding ants indoors regularly are all clear indicators that you have a pest problem that requires professional intervention. Don't assume that seeing just one or two means there aren't more hiding out of sight.

Damaged Plants in and Around Your Home

Pests don't just bother us indoors; they can also wreak havoc on our gardens and houseplants. Chewed leaves, stunted growth, or unusual spots and discoloration on plants can be signs of insect pests like aphids, spider mites, or caterpillars. Our pest control services can extend to the perimeter of your home to help protect your landscaping and prevent outdoor pests from making their way indoors.

Unexplained Bites or Skin Irritations

Waking up with unexplained itchy bites can be a distressing sign of pests like bed bugs or even certain types of mites. Identifying the source of these bites is crucial for effective treatment and preventing further discomfort. A professional pest control expert can help determine the cause of the bites and implement the necessary steps for eradication. Sometimes, these bites are mistaken for other skin conditions.

Nocturnal Noises

Scratching, scurrying, chirping, or rustling sounds coming from your walls, attics, or crawl spaces, especially at night, are often a sign of rodent or other wildlife activity. These noises can be unsettling and indicate that pests are nesting or moving within your home's structure. Identifying the location and type of noise can help pinpoint the source of the infestation, which is a crucial first step in developing a plan for removal. Listen carefully for patterns and times of activity.

Mud Tubes or Earthen Structures

Termites, particularly subterranean termites, build mud tubes to travel between their colony in the soil and their food source (your home's wood). These tubes are typically found on foundation walls, floor joists, or other wooden structures. Discovering these tubes is a serious indicator of a termite infestation that requires immediate professional attention to prevent significant structural damage. Don't disturb these tubes before a professional inspection.

Damaged Packaging or Food Contamination

Pests like rodents and pantry pests can chew through food packaging to access contents. If you notice ripped bags of flour, cereal boxes with holes, or other signs of tampering in your pantry or food storage areas, it's a strong indicator of pest activity. This not only leads to wasted food but also poses health risks due to potential contamination. Inspect all food items regularly for signs of damage.

Visible Nests or Webs

Finding nests made of various materials (paper, mud, plant fibers) built by wasps, bees, birds, or rodents in or around your home is a clear sign of their presence. Similarly, an abundance of spiderwebs, particularly in secluded areas like attics, basements, or eaves, indicates a significant spider population. Removing these nests and controlling the populations requires a professional approach to ensure safety and effectiveness. Be cautious when approaching visible nests.

Increased Activity Outdoors Near Your Home

Sometimes, pest problems indoors start with increased activity right outside your doorstep. Noticeable populations of ants trailing along sidewalks, excessive numbers of mosquitoes in your yard, or finding rodent burrows near your foundation can all be precursors to indoor infestations. Foul Odor from Drains

Certain drain flies or other insect pests can breed in the organic matter that accumulates in drains, leading to unpleasant odors. If you notice foul smells coming from your sinks or showers that don't dissipate with normal cleaning, it could indicate a pest issue within your plumbing. Professional pest control can help identify and treat these types of infestations by focusing on the breeding sites.

Pilot Holes in Wood

Small, perfectly round holes in wooden surfaces can be a sign of wood-boring insects like powderpost beetles. These pests bore into wood and can cause significant structural damage over time. If you notice these types of holes accompanied by a fine powdery dust (frass), it's important to have the area inspected by a professional to determine the extent of the infestation and the appropriate course of action. Early detection is key with wood-boring pests.

Wings Left Behind

Swarming termites and ants can leave behind discarded wings after they have mated and found a suitable location to establish a new colony. Finding small piles of delicate wings on windowsills or near doorways can be a sign of a nearby termite or ant colony. This is particularly concerning if the wings are clear and uniform in size, which can indicate termites. Don't ignore these small but important clues.

Rustling or Scratching Sounds in Walls or Ceilings

Beyond the obvious signs, some pests announce their presence through sounds. The sound of scratching, gnawing, or even the faint rustling of insects in your walls or ceilings is a clear indicator of activity within those hidden spaces. These sounds are often more noticeable during quiet hours and can pinpoint the general location of the infestation, allowing for more targeted inspection and treatment. These sounds can be particularly unnerving at night.

Seeing Pests in Specific Areas

The type of pest you see and where you see it can provide valuable clues. Finding ants in the kitchen, spiders in the basement, or bed bugs in bedrooms all point to specific types of infestations that require specialized treatments. Recognizing these patterns helps in identifying the pest species and developing an effective eradication strategy. Each pest has its preferred harborage areas and food sources.

Damage to Fabrics or Paper

Certain pests, such as silverfish or clothes moths, feed on natural fibers found in clothing, upholstery, and paper. Discovering unexplained holes in clothing, damage to books, or other signs of fabric or paper consumption can indicate the presence of these pests. Proper identification is necessary for effective treatment to protect your belongings. Storing items in airtight containers can sometimes help prevent this.

Excessive Numbers of Flying Insects Indoors

While the occasional fly or mosquito indoors is not uncommon, an unusually high number of flying insects suggests a potential breeding source nearby. This could be standing water, rotting organic matter, or even a cluster fly infestation. Identifying and eliminating the breeding source is crucial for long-term relief from flying pests. Our mosquito control services can address outdoor breeding grounds which can reduce indoor populations.

The Presence of Webbing (Excluding Spiderwebs)

Some pests, like pantry moths or certain stored product pests, create silken webbing in food items or around containers. Finding this type of webbing in your pantry or kitchen cabinets is a clear sign of an infestation. These pests can contaminate food and spread quickly if not addressed promptly. Discarding infested food and thorough cleaning is the first step, followed by professional treatment if necessary.

Grease Marks or Smudges

Rodents tend to follow the same paths along walls and baseboards, leaving behind greasy marks or smudges from the oils and dirt on their fur. If you notice these streaks in areas where you suspect rodent activity, it further confirms their presence and helps identify their travel routes, which is useful for strategic baiting or trapping. These marks are often more noticeable in high-traffic rodent areas.

Visible Insect Eggs or Larvae

While sometimes difficult to spot, finding clusters of insect eggs or larvae can indicate an active breeding site within your home. These may be found in secluded areas, on surfaces, or even on food items. Identifying the type of eggs or larvae can help determine the specific pest and the best course of action for elimination. A professional inspection can often reveal these hidden signs of infestation.

Unexplained Damage to Wood

Beyond gnaw marks, other types of damage to wood can indicate pest infestations. Honeycomb-like patterns in wood can point to carpenter ants nesting internally. Soft, decaying wood can be a sign of moisture damage which attracts termites and other wood-destroying insects. A thorough inspection can differentiate between various types of wood damage and identify the culprit, leading to appropriate treatment solutions.
